    Searching for Central Rockola Vista SP1 typically relates to a specialized software suite used for managing digital jukeboxes (videorockolas). It is important to distinguish between the software and the operating system (Windows Vista) it is named after. Software Overview

    Central Rockola Vista SP1 is a jukebox management program designed by Afranio Lozano to handle music and video playback in commercial or personal rockolas.

    Key Files: The software bundle usually includes Central Vista Sp1.exe (the main player), Activacion.exe (for license management), and Winlirc (for remote control integration).

    Licensing: Contrary to some "free" download claims, the software historically requires a paid license. The Activacion.exe tool generates a unique serial number that must be sent to the developer or vendor to receive a valid activation key. Common Features:

    Support for remote controls (often Sony Trinitron models) via Winlirc.

    Keyboard shortcuts for coin insertion tracking and configuration (e.g., pressing 'C' for revenue statistics or 'H' for help). Database management for music and videos. Archive & Download Status

    While users often look for "full gratis" (completely free) versions on platforms like the Internet Archive, most entries found there under "Vista SP1" refer to Microsoft Windows Vista Service Pack 1 operating system ISOs rather than the specific jukebox software.

    Central Rockola Vista SP1 is a specialized jukebox (videorockola) software widely used in Colombia for managing music and video playback in commercial or personal digital jukeboxes. While it is often sought after as a "free" or "full" download, it is originally a paid software that requires a license key for activation. Key Features & Capabilities

    Media Support: Plays standard formats including MP3, WMA, AVI, MPEG, DIVX, and WMV.

    Colombian Interface Style: Features a vertical list interface (Artist/Song) on the left side, typical of Colombian jukebox culture, rather than the album-cover-based style of other programs.

    Hardware Control: Integrated with Winlirc, allowing full operation (volume, credits, navigation) via standard TV remote controls.

    Advanced Statistics: Tracks the most and least played songs to help owners optimize their music library and remove "garbage" tracks.

    Interactive Camera: Can automatically activate a webcam to show users on the screen between songs. Installation & Activation

    Unlike standard software with a typical installer, Central Rockola Vista SP1 usually consists of a folder that you copy directly to your hard drive. Execution: Run Central Vista Sp1.exe from the folder.

    Activation: The software uses a Llave.exe (Key) program that generates a unique serial based on your PC hardware.

    Music Database: You must press 'A' to set the music path and update the database.

    Shortcuts: Most functions are mapped to specific fixed keys (e.g., 'H' for help, 'Z' for settings, 'C' for credit counters). Resources & Downloads
